现在的位置: 首页 > 综合 > 正文

常用javascript技巧汇总

2012年05月26日 ⁄ 综合 ⁄ 共 1152字 ⁄ 字号 评论关闭

javascript是动态交互的很好的脚本语言,下面是我总结的常用的javascript技巧.
(1).在html页面中引用:
<script language="javascript">......</script>//方式一
<script language="javascript" src="js文件所在路径(一般是相对路径)"/>

(2)加入收藏: <a href="javascript:window.external.AddFavorite(location.href,document.title)">加入收藏</a>其中location.href指当前页面,document.title指加入收藏时,显示给用户的友好提示的(以方便记忆)的文本.

(3)在asp.net服务器端弹出提示框,单击确定后,返回到上一页面:Reponse.write("<script>alert('XXX');history.go(-1);</script>");

(4)页面另存为:<a href="#" onclick ="document.execCommand('saveAs')">另存为</a>

(5)在页面上单击"回车"键,相当于触发一个button:

function document.onkeydown ()
  {
      if(event.keyCode==13)//注意大小写,判断单击是否为回车
      {
      document.getElementById ("btnOk").click();//btnOk为服务器端控件
      return false;//一定要有
      }
     
  }
  /*如果接收密码的文本框是客户端控件,也可以做如下定义,然后做如下
  //调用<input id="pwd" onkeydown="EnterDown(按钮对象名)"/>
  function EnterDown(Obj)
  {
      if(event.keyCode==13)
      {
      Obj.click();
      }
  }
  */

(6)弹出一个新的窗口:<a  href ="#" onclick ="window.open('KeepPasswordOnPageAfterSubmit.aspx','_blank','height=500,width=100,toolbar=no,menubar=no,location=no')">打开</a>

(7)当删除或关闭时,弹出提示对话框:<input id="Button3" type="button" value="button" onclick ="javascript:if(confirm('确实要关闭?'))window.close();" /></div>

抱歉!评论已关闭.